9. Weather Insights

Understanding the weather is crucial for planning your trip. Sripur experiences a tropical climate with distinct seasons.

  • Summer (March to June): Hot and humid, with temperatures soaring above 35°C. It’s advisable to carry water and wear light clothing.
  • Monsoon (July to September): Heavy rainfall can occur, making it a lush green paradise but also challenging for outdoor activities.
  • Winter (October to February): The most pleasant time to visit, with temperatures ranging from 10°C to 25°C.
